Graphic Design Builds Brand Identity
Every successful business has a recognizable visual identity.
Think about some of the world’s biggest brands. Their colors, typography, layouts, packaging, and advertising style become instantly recognizable over time.
That consistency creates familiarity.
And familiarity creates trust.
Brand identity includes:
Logo design
Brand colors
Typography
Packaging
Social media aesthetics
Website visuals
Marketing materials
Advertising creatives
When all these elements feel connected, customers remember your brand more easily.
Businesses without consistent branding often appear less reliable or less established, even if their service quality is excellent.

Common Graphic Design Mistakes Businesses Still Make
Inconsistent Branding
Using random colors, fonts, and styles across platforms weakens brand identity.
Consistency builds recognition.
Overcrowded Visuals
Too much text, too many elements, and poor spacing confuse audiences.
Simple and focused designs often perform better.
Ignoring Mobile Design
Most users now consume content on mobile devices.
Designs must be optimized for smaller screens.
Following Every Trend Blindly
Trends change quickly.
Businesses should balance modern visuals with timeless branding principles.
Poor Quality Graphics
Blurry visuals, outdated layouts, and low-quality creatives damage credibility instantly.
Professional presentation matters.
